Understanding Correlation

At its heart, correlation measures the degree to which two assets move in relation to one another. A positive correlation means they tend to move in the same direction, while a negative correlation means they move in opposite directions. In the crypto space, the strongest correlations are generally found between futures contracts and their corresponding spot altcoins. For example, the Bitcoin perpetual swap (a type of futures contract) on a given exchange should, in theory, closely track the price of Bitcoin on spot exchanges.

However, this relationship isn't always perfect. Market inefficiencies, arbitrage opportunities, and varying levels of liquidity can cause temporary divergences. These divergences are where correlation traders seek to profit.

  • Positive Correlation:* When Bitcoin's price increases, the Bitcoin perpetual swap price *should* also increase. A trader might go long (buy) both Bitcoin and the Bitcoin future.
  • Negative Correlation:* While less common between spot and futures of the same asset, negative correlations can exist between different assets (e.g., Bitcoin and Ethereum during specific market conditions).

It’s crucial to understand that correlation is not causation. Just because two assets move together doesn't mean one causes the other. External factors, such as macroeconomic events, regulatory news, or even global pandemics (as discussed in The Role of Pandemics in Futures Markets), can influence both assets simultaneously.

Why Trade Correlation?

Correlation trading offers several advantages:

  • Reduced Market Risk: By taking opposing positions in correlated assets, you can hedge against directional risk. If one trade goes against you, the other may offset the loss.
  • Arbitrage Opportunities: When discrepancies arise, traders can exploit them through arbitrage, locking in risk-free profits.
  • Increased Profit Potential: Combining positions can amplify gains when the correlation holds as expected.
  • Flexibility: Correlation trading can be adapted to various market conditions and risk profiles.

However, it's not without its challenges:

  • Complexity: Requires a good understanding of both spot and futures markets.
  • Execution Risk: Successfully executing trades in both markets simultaneously can be difficult.
  • Funding Costs: Holding positions in futures contracts incurs funding rates (periodic payments between long and short positions).
  • Correlation Breakdown: Correlations can break down unexpectedly, leading to losses.


Core Strategies for Correlation Trading

Several strategies can be employed, ranging from simple to complex. Here are some of the most common:

1. Statistical Arbitrage

This strategy relies on identifying statistically significant deviations from the historical correlation between an altcoin's spot price and its futures contract.

  • Process: Collect historical price data for both assets. Calculate the correlation coefficient. Monitor real-time prices for deviations exceeding a pre-defined threshold (e.g., two standard deviations from the mean correlation).
  • Trade Setup: If the futures contract is trading at a premium (higher price than spot), short the futures and long the spot altcoin. Conversely, if the futures are at a discount, long the futures and short the spot altcoin.
  • Exit Strategy: Close the positions when the correlation reverts to its historical mean or when a profit target is reached.

2. Basis Trading

Basis trading focuses on the “basis,” which is the difference between the futures price and the spot price. A positive basis indicates the futures price is higher than the spot price, while a negative basis suggests the opposite.

  • Process: Monitor the basis for altcoins with active futures markets.
  • Trade Setup: If the basis is unusually high (indicating an overvalued futures contract), short the futures and hedge with a long position in the spot altcoin. If the basis is unusually low (indicating an undervalued futures contract), long the futures and hedge with a short position in the spot altcoin.
  • Exit Strategy: Close the positions when the basis reverts to its normal range.

3. Convergence Trading

This strategy anticipates that the futures price will converge with the spot price as the contract approaches its expiration date.

  • Process: Identify altcoins with futures contracts nearing expiration.
  • Trade Setup: If the futures price is significantly higher than the spot price, short the futures and long the spot. If the futures price is significantly lower, long the futures and short the spot.
  • Exit Strategy: Close the positions shortly before the expiration date, capitalizing on the expected convergence.

4. Pair Trading with Multiple Altcoins

This advanced strategy involves identifying correlated pairs of altcoins (e.g., Ethereum and Litecoin) and trading the relative value between them. While less directly tied to futures, it can be combined with futures positions for enhanced hedging.

  • Process: Identify altcoin pairs with a strong historical correlation.
  • Trade Setup: If one altcoin outperforms the other, short the outperformer and long the underperformer.
  • Exit Strategy: Close the positions when the relative value between the altcoins reverts to its historical mean.

Risk Management in Correlation Trading

Correlation trading, while potentially profitable, is not risk-free. Effective risk management is crucial.

  • Position Sizing: Never risk more than 1-2% of your trading capital on a single trade.
  • Stop-Loss Orders: Always use stop-loss orders to limit potential losses. Determine appropriate stop-loss levels based on volatility and correlation history.
  • Correlation Monitoring: Continuously monitor the correlation between the assets. If the correlation breaks down, be prepared to exit the trade.
  • Funding Rate Risk: Be aware of funding rates in perpetual futures contracts. High funding rates can erode profits.
  • Liquidity Risk: Ensure sufficient liquidity in both the spot and futures markets to execute trades efficiently.
  • Hedging: Properly hedge your positions to minimize directional risk.
  • Diversification: Don't rely on a single correlation trade. Diversify across multiple pairs to reduce overall risk.

Example Trade Scenario: Bitcoin Futures and Spot

Let's illustrate with a simplified example:

1. Observation: Bitcoin is trading at $60,000 on the spot market. The Bitcoin perpetual swap on Bybit is trading at $60,500. The historical correlation between the two is very high (0.95). 2. Analysis: The futures contract is trading at a $500 premium. This suggests the futures may be overvalued. 3. Trade Setup: Short 1 Bitcoin perpetual swap contract on Bybit. Long 1 Bitcoin on a spot exchange like Coinbase. 4. Position Sizing: Allocate 1% of your trading capital to each side of the trade. 5. Stop-Loss: Set a stop-loss order at $61,000 for the short futures position and $59,500 for the long spot position. 6. Target: Aim to close the positions when the futures price converges with the spot price, ideally around $60,000. 7. Monitoring: Continuously monitor the correlation and adjust stop-loss levels as needed.

If the futures price converges with the spot price, you would profit from the difference. However, if the futures price continues to rise, your stop-loss orders would be triggered, limiting your losses.
